Shipyard Old Port 5K
Location: Portland, ME
Date: June
The Shipyard Old Port 5K in Portland, Maine, offers a scenic and vibrant course through this bustling coastal city. Firstly, the race begins in the heart of Portland’s historic Old Port district, surrounded by cobblestone streets and charming waterfront views. Runners start their journey on well-paved roads, greeted by the lively energy of the city. Then, the course winds through the Old Port’s bustling streets, showcasing its unique mix of historic and modern architecture.
Additionally, the 5K route highlights Portland’s picturesque waterfront and vibrant downtown areas. Here, runners can enjoy the sight of working fishing boats, quaint shops, and scenic harbors. Furthermore, the path includes stretches that offer expansive views of Casco Bay, adding a refreshing coastal element to the race. The combination of urban charm and seaside scenery keeps the course engaging and enjoyable.
Moreover, the course features primarily flat terrain, making it accessible yet exciting for runners of all skill levels. As participants navigate the route, they are treated to the sights and sounds of Portland’s active waterfront, bustling streets, and vibrant community. Meanwhile, the festive energy of the event and cheering crowds along the way enhance the overall experience.
Ultimately, the Shipyard Old Port 5K concludes near the waterfront, where runners celebrate with post-race festivities and a lively atmosphere. The mix of historic charm, scenic waterfront views, and energetic surroundings makes this 5K truly memorable. Whether you’re an experienced runner or a first-timer, this race promises a rewarding experience.

Flight Deck 5K
Location: Brunswick, ME
Date: September
The Flight Deck 5K in Brunswick, Maine, offers runners a unique and enjoyable course through this vibrant coastal town. Starting at the historic Brunswick Landing, participants are immediately immersed in the energy of the former naval air station turned thriving community. This exciting setting sets a motivating tone for the entire race.
Moreover, the course takes runners through a variety of terrains, showcasing the charm and natural beauty of Brunswick. Participants traverse well-maintained paths, pass by modern developments and historic hangars, and run along tree-lined roads. Additionally, the route includes stretches with scenic views of the surrounding fields and wooded areas, blending urban revitalization with natural tranquility. These diverse settings keep runners captivated and engaged throughout the race.
Furthermore, the 5K features a mostly flat course with gentle curves, providing a steady pace and manageable challenges. The thoughtfully designed route flows seamlessly through Brunswick’s unique landscape, offering fresh and delightful scenery at every turn. The balance of interesting landmarks and serene surroundings makes the race both enjoyable and rewarding. This combination of accessibility and scenic appeal ensures runners of all levels have a memorable experience.
Finally, the race concludes with a festive finish back at Brunswick Landing, where cheering spectators and a lively atmosphere await. The final stretch is lined with supporters, creating an uplifting and celebratory environment. Crossing the finish line in such a dynamic and welcoming setting is a triumphant moment for every participant. For those seeking a 5K that combines local charm with a touch of history, the Flight Deck 5K is an excellent choice.

Trail Festival at Pineland Farms 5K
Location: New Gloucester, ME
Date: May
The Trail Festival at Pineland Farms 5K in New Gloucester, Maine, offers runners a scenic and invigorating course through the picturesque trails of this expansive recreational area. Starting near the iconic Pineland Farms campus, participants are immediately surrounded by rolling hills and open meadows. This tranquil and inspiring setting creates the perfect atmosphere for the race.
Moreover, the course takes runners through a variety of terrains, showcasing the natural beauty and serene charm of Pineland Farms. Participants navigate well-maintained dirt paths, run through dense woodlands, and traverse wide fields bordered by lush greenery. Additionally, the route features stretches with stunning views of the surrounding countryside, where the peaceful landscapes enhance the experience. These diverse settings ensure runners stay captivated and motivated throughout the event.
Furthermore, the 5K includes a mix of rolling hills and flat sections, offering both gentle challenges and opportunities to maintain a steady pace. The thoughtfully designed route winds seamlessly through Pineland’s scenic trails, with each segment revealing new and delightful vistas. The combination of natural tranquility and varied terrain makes the race both rewarding and enjoyable. This balance of effort and beauty ensures participants of all levels have a memorable time.
Finally, the race concludes with a festive finish back at the Pineland Farms campus, where supporters and celebratory activities await. Crossing the finish line in such a picturesque and supportive setting is a triumphant moment for all participants. For those seeking a 5K that blends trail running with scenic beauty, the Trail Festival at Pineland Farms 5K is an excellent choice.
